Member Benefits
Discounts

Members are also eligible for the club discount rates for subscriptions to Sky & Telescope and Astronomy magazines, as well as discounts at various businesses in the Tallahassee area.

Lending Library

We have an extensive library of over 50 astronomical titles as well as periodicals, software, slides and videos. They are only available for lending to members of TAS.

Equipment
  • Telescopes - These are available for rental at a cost of 5$ per month to TAS members only. We have the following telescopes:
    • 6" f4 Cave Astrola Newtonian GEM
    • 6" fX ???? Newtonian GEM
    • 6" ???? Newtonian AltAz
    • 60mm Sears Refractor AltAz
  • Laser Collimator
  • Various Eye Pieces
StarHill, The TAS Dark Observing Site

One acre on a hill (elevation 90ft) with clear horizons far from the lights of Tallahassee. Access to StarHill is ONLY available to TAS members, and their guests. For directions on how to get there please contact our secretary. The facilities available at the site are:

  • Two bedroom house with two bathrooms, meeting and storage rooms.
  • Observatory - Currently being renovated
    • 14" Celestron SCT GEM
    • Electrically powered 10ft Ash dome
    • 7x24 access to members only!
  • Several grassy sites
  • Two outdoor power outlets
  • One Permanent outdoor pier
